  17. Shudder. Wolf Turns. HATE. HATE. HAAAAAAATTTTE. Simone is the only one that makes them palatable. Because she's not wobbly as hell when she does them. Oh, figure skating. Sorry. Am I the only one that hates the "jump with your arms in the air for extra points every stinking time you jump?" EVERY. TIME. for some of these girls (especially). It reminds me of when the scoring system was new(ish) and they gave bonus points for catch foot spins and you saw all sorts of really bad ones. Some skaters were grabbing their skates EVERY time they spun. There was a Georgian skater, Eleni Gedevanishvili, who must have done 10 spins with her skate blade in her hand, in a single program. Bad Biellmann and Bad Boitano is the Wolf Turn for skating.

  22. She got the silver in Vault because she had too much power on Biles II and sat down on the landing. Even though the vault is head and shoulders above anything anyone is attempting, the sit down, paired with a deduction for her coach being on the mat, gave Andrade the gold. If you're going to attempt a vault as dangerous as the Biles II, having a coach spotting you closely seems like a necessary safety precaution. Instead, she got a deduction. Whatever.
